转基因杂交棉不同组合农艺性状、产量和品质的研究

摘要: 为了探索转基因抗虫杂交棉新组合农艺性状、产量和品质特性,加快对转基因性状的应用,服务于农业生产。在大田生产条件下,对5个转基因抗虫杂交棉新组合的农艺性状、产量和品质性状进行了比较研究。结果表明:与对照‘湘杂棉7号’相比,生育期、株高、果枝数无明显差异;A3叶绿素含量、产量、纤维品质均优于对照;A5叶绿素含量较高,产量无显著差异,纤维品质较优。A1、A2、A4叶片叶绿素含量低,皮棉减产,品质也略差。综合各方面的因素,A3叶绿色含量高,有利于光合产物生产和供应,且铃大,产量高,纤维品质优,符合湖南省棉花新品种审定产量质量要求。

Abstract: In order to explore the transgenic insect-resistant hybrid cotton agronomic traits, yield and quality characteristics, speed up the application of transgenic traits, serve the agricultural production. The economical characteristic, yield and quality were studied under filed conditions with six transgenic insect-resistant hybrid cotton cultivars. The results were as follows: compared with ‘Xiangzamian 7’ (CK), A3 showed higher SPAD value in leaves part of the time, and the same level yield and fabrics. A5 showed higher SPAD value in leaves, and lower yield and higher-quality fabrics. A1, A2 and A4 showed lower SPAD value in leaves, lower yield and poorer-quality fabrics.
